What is a dual battery electric bike?

For those who are new to the world of electric bicycles, a dual battery electric bike is an e-bike that comes equipped with two separate batteries, each providing power to the motor. This setup allows you to extend your riding range, increase your overall power output, and enjoy a more convenient and flexible riding experience.

How do dual batteries work?

The dual battery setup on an e-bike is designed to provide you with more power, range, and flexibility. But have you ever wondered how it actually works?

  • Battery configuration options: Batteries can be configured in either parallel or series connections. In a parallel connection, both batteries are connected together to increase the overall capacity, allowing you to ride farther on a single charge. In a series connection, the batteries are connected one after the other, increasing the voltage and providing more power.
  • Power distribution and motor efficiency: Battery power is distributed to the motor through a sophisticated system that ensures efficient energy transfer. The dual battery setup allows for more consistent power delivery, reducing the strain on the motor and increasing its overall efficiency.
  • Precise control over motor: Dual batteries enable more precise control over the motor’s power output. This results in a smoother ride, improved acceleration, and better hill-climbing capabilities. Additionally, the increased power output can be used to power additional accessories, such as lights or GPS devices, without draining the batteries quickly.

Drawbacks of dual batteries in e-bikes

While dual battery electric bikes offer several advantages, they also come with some drawbacks that you should be aware of before making a purchase.

  • Added weight and complexity: The undeniable benefit of extra power comes with the burden of additional weight. Two batteries can affect your e-bike’s handling and maneuverability, especially when navigating tight spaces or lifting the bike without motor assistance. Consider this factor if you prioritize agility or ease of storage and transportation.
  • Higher cost and maintenance: One of the most significant drawbacks of dual battery e-bikes is the higher cost and maintenance requirements. Batteries are a major expense, and having two doubles the financial investment. Additionally, you’ll need to factor in the cost of maintaining and replacing two batteries, which can add up over time. This can be a significant consideration for budget-conscious riders.
  • Limited compatibility and upgradability: Dual battery systems can limit your upgrade options in the future. Both batteries need to be compatible with each other and your e-bike’s system, potentially restricting your ability to swap out individual components or integrate new technologies. This could leave you stuck with outdated technology or force a complete system replacement down the line. Additionally, you may find that certain accessories or upgrades are not compatible with dual battery systems, further limiting your options.

Range comparison dual battery ebike vs single battery ebike

When comparing the range of dual battery electric bikes to single battery models, the difference is significant and often a deciding factor for many riders. Dual battery electric bikes typically offer nearly double the range of their single battery counterparts, allowing riders to cover greater distances without the need for frequent recharging.

For instance, if a single battery electric bike can cover 30-50 miles on a full charge, a dual battery system could potentially extend that range to 60-100 miles or more, depending on factors such as terrain, rider weight, and riding style. This extended range is particularly beneficial for long-distance commuters, touring cyclists, and those who prefer the peace of mind that comes with extra battery capacity. Additionally, the ability to switch between batteries or use them simultaneously ensures a more consistent power output, making dual battery electric bikes not just a convenience, but a necessity for those who need reliability over longer rides.

Battery charging time of dual battery e-bike

The charging time for dual battery electric bikes can vary depending on the capacity of the batteries and the type of charger used. Generally, dual battery systems take longer to charge than single battery bikes due to the increased capacity. However, the total charging time can be managed in a few ways.

  1. Simultaneous Charging: If the bike allows for both batteries to be charged simultaneously using separate chargers, the overall charging time is essentially the same as charging a single battery. For example, if each battery takes 4-6 hours to fully charge, charging them at the same time would also take 4-6 hours.
  2. Sequential Charging: If the bike uses a single charger and batteries are charged one after the other, the total charging time will be cumulative. So, if each battery takes 4-6 hours to charge, the total time for both could be 8-12 hours.
  3. Fast Chargers: Some dual battery systems support fast charging, which can significantly reduce the charging time for each battery, often cutting it down to 2-3 hours per battery.

While dual battery systems generally require more charging time due to their larger capacity, using simultaneous charging or fast chargers can effectively manage and reduce this time, making dual battery electric bikes a practical option for frequent or long-distance riders.

Can I upgrade my existing e-bike to dual batteries?

Yes, you upgrade the existing e-bike to dual batteries. While it’s technically possible to upgrade your existing e-bike to dual batteries, it’s important to check if your bike’s motor and controller can support the additional power. Additionally, you may need to modify your bike’s wiring and electrical system to accommodate the second battery.
